WebPostprandial somnolence (colloquially known as food coma, after-dinner dip, and postprandial sleep, or by the African-American Vernacular English term the itis [1]) is a normal state of drowsiness or lassitude following a meal. Postprandial somnolence has two components: a general state of low energy related to activation of the parasympathetic ... WebKoulu [1] wanted to find optimum dose of L-tryptophan for human growth hormone secretion. 2, 5 and 8 g L-tryptophan was given orally in random order to 8 healthy male volunteers. When comparing L-tryptophan with placebo, significant stimulation of human growth hormone release was observed (p<0.001) and 5 grams seems to be most suitable …

WebTryptophan plays a role in "feast-induced" drowsiness. Ingestion of a meal rich in carbohydrates triggers the release of insulin. Insulin, in turn, stimulates the uptake of large neutral branched-chain amino acids (BCAAs) into muscle, increasing the ratio of tryptophan to BCAA in the bloodstream.
